Rashee Rice

SMU WR

Games Watched: Cincinnati, Houston, Tulane 

Summary: Rashee Rice is a receiver who moves well for his size. He not only has speed to beat defenders deep, but also has decent change of direction skills. He is a good route runner and does a lot of things well technically. He can create separation, but too often he doesn’t attack the ball and drops catchable passes. Other times he’ll try to play too fast leading to him being out of control.

Pros

  • Good movement skills
  • Has the speed to get behind defenders
  • Body feints well to create separation
  • Great at legally hand fighting with defenders
  • Positions his body well
  • Often one of the first players to react to the snap

Cons

  • Often plays too fast and out of control
  • Does not vary his release package
  • Terrible drop issues
  • Does not attack the ball in the air

Grade: Rashee Rice gets a 4th round grade. He has potential, but there are a lot of things coaches would need to fix to get him to unlock this potential.
